Let f(x) = 5x – 4 and g(x) = x² – 1. Find each value.
(gºf)(-1)
(fºg)(2)
(gºf)(0)
f(g(16)
f(g(0))
g(f(4/5))

Step-by-step explanation:

In simplified terms the question is asking

35.)   g(f(-1)) =

         g(-9) = 80

36.)   f(g(2)) =

         f(3) = 11

37.)   g(f(0)) =

        g(-4) = 15

38.)   f(g(root6)) =

         f(5) = 21

39.)   f(g(0)) =

         f(-1) = -9

40.)   g(f(4/5)) =

         g(0) = -1
